MEMS ammonia gas sensors use MEMS technology to make micro-hot plates on Si-based substrates. The gas-sensitive materials used are metal oxide semiconductor materials with low conductivity in clean air. When there is a detected gas in the ambient air, the conductivity of the sensor changes. The higher the concentration of the gas, the higher the conductivity of the sensor. Using a simple circuit, the change in conductivity can be converted into an output signal corresponding to the gas concentration.
main application:
It is widely used in refrigerator gas detection, cold storage ammonia leak detection and agricultural breeding ventilation control.
Product model: GM-802B
Product type: MEMS ammonia gas sensor
Standard package: ceramic package
Detection gas: ammonia
Detection concentration: 1~300ppm(NH3)
Standard circuit conditions
Loop voltage VC: ≤24V DC
Heating voltage VH: 2.0V±0.1V AC or DC
Load resistance RL: adjustable
Gas sensor characteristics under standard test conditions
Heating resistance RH: 80Ω±20Ω (room temperature)
Heating power consumption PH: ≤45mW
Sensitive body resistance RS: 1KΩ~30KΩ (in 50ppmNH3)
Sensitivity S: R0(in air)/Rs(in 50ppmNH3)≥3
Concentration slope α: ≤0.9(R200ppm/R50ppmNH3)
Standard test conditions
Temperature, humidity 20ºC±2ºC; 55%±5%RH
Standard test circuit:
VH: 2.0V±0.1V;
VC: 5.0V±0.1V
